Where would we be without the internet.
With winter rapidly on its way, the availability of the internet becomes a tad more important, particularly for we retirees. It fills the odd gaps in the days when we have inclement weather, it allows us to to fully contribute in the running of our community facilities (the heating systems can be controlled from home, or on a cruise for that matter). We can stay in regular contact with friends and family. Friends who have lost their partners say how much it can enhance their lives.
Yes, warts and all,I wonder how we would be without it.
